1,1)# 通过timedelta将天数加到第一天上target_date=start+timedelta(days=day_of_year-1)returntarget_date# 示例:将2023年第60天转换为日期year=2023day_of_year=60date=day_of_year_to_date(year,day_of_year)print(f"{year}年第{day_of_year}天是:{date....
使用方法:datediff(interval,date1,date2)。 参数interval和dateadd函数中的interval参数内容描述相同,date1和date2参数分别就是相互比较的两个日期时间。另外,当date1的日期时间值大于date2时,将显示为负值。 比如DateDiff("yyyy","1982-7-18",date)表示某人的出生到现在已经多少年了。又比如DateDiff("d","1982-...
Example 1: Python Add Years to Date main.py fromdatetimeimportdatetimefromdateutil.relativedeltaimportrelativedelta# Get Random DatemyDateString="2022-06-01"myDate=datetime.strptime(myDateString,"%Y-%m-%d")addYearNumber=2;newDate=myDate+relativedelta(years=addYearNumber)print("Old Date :")print(...
df['datetime'] = pd.to_datetime(df['date'] +' '+df['time'])df['datetime']具体合并结果如下所示。2022-1-112::12022-1-213:30:22022-1-315:45:32022-1-418:20:Name: datetime, dtype: datetime64[ns]接下来,我们可以使用datetime模块提供的各种功能来处理日期和时间数据。例如,我们可以提取年份...
df['datetime64']=pd.to_datetime(df['date']) 日期转字符串 ? 代码语言:javascript 代码运行次数:0 运行 AI代码解释 # 日期转字符串 df['date_str']=df['datetime64'].apply(lambda x:x.strftime('%Y-%m-%d %H:%M:%S')) 13位的时间戳转 日期格式str ?
local= utc.to("America/New_York")print(local) Maya Maya是一个简单而强大的库,旨在简化日期和时间的使用,尤其是在处理相对时间和自然语言输入时。 importmaya#获取当前时间now =maya.now()print(now)#解析自然语言日期date = maya.when("next friday at 5pm")print(date)#转换为其他格式iso_format =date...
date_string="25 December, 2022"print("date_string =",date_string)# usestrptime()to create date object date_object=datetime.strptime(date_string,"%d %B, %Y")print("date_object =",date_object) 二、使用datetime库计算某月最后一天 假设给定年和月份,这里用的计算逻辑方法是,下个月的1号减去这个...
date.min:最小日期 date.max:最大日期 date.resolution: 两个日期对象的最小间隔 例子如下: from datetime import date print(date.min) #0001-01-01 print(date.max) #9999-12-31 print(date.resolution) #1 day, 0:00:00 主要对象属性(需要定义类的对象):date.year、date.month、date.day,分别是年、...
year的范围是[MINYEAR, MAXYEAR],即[1, 9999];month的范围是[1, 12]。(月份是从1开始的,不是从0开始的~_~);day的最大值根据给定的year, month参数来决定。例如闰年2月份有29天; date类定义了一些常用的类方法与类属性,方便我们操作: date.max、date.min:date对象所能表示的最大、最小日期;date.resol...
date_string = '2022-01-01 11:12:13' date = dateutil.parser.parse(date_string) print('Parsed Date:', date) # 替换年份为2023 # 其他参数:year,month,day,hour,minute,second,microsecond,tzinfo new_date = date.replace(year=2023) formatted_date = new_date.strftime('%Y-%m-%d %H:%M:%S'...